Only time will reveal the impact of these choices on viewer retention and sign-ups.On the heels of a vibrant May packed with noteworthy content, including the explosive season finale of *The Boys* and John Krasinski’s return in *Jack Ryan*, Prime Video is gearing up for summer. They've unveiled their June schedule, featuring an impressive lineup that includes a diverse range of films and series. Viewers will find a total of 91 new titles this month—87 movies and four TV series. Among the highlights are beloved classics like *Bull Durham* and *Mad Max*, along with not just one, but two *Legally Blonde* films. But it’s not just about nostalgia; Prime Video is embracing Pride Month with a thoughtfully curated selection. This features original content that aims to highlight and celebrate LGBTQ+ narratives. Expected titles in this collection include the animated comedy *Hazbin Hotel* and Aubrey Plaza's engaging coming-of-age film, *My Old Ass*, alongside the final chapter of *Good Omens*. Full access to this specially curated lineup will start on June 1. Sports enthusiasts won't be left wanting either; June brings a slew of MLB games, WNBA action, National Women's Soccer League matchups, and NASCAR races. ### Clarkson’s Farm, Season 5 (June 3) #### Jeremy Clarkson's Rural Antics Continue The former *Top Gear* host Jeremy Clarkson is back, trading track-day thrills for the unpredictable world of farming in the fifth season of *Clarkson’s Farm*, launching on June 3. This popular reality show chronicles Clarkson’s often hilarious attempts to manage his Diddly Squat Farm in the English countryside, much to the delight of its audience. Having wrapped season four with the opening of his pub, *The Farmer's Dog*, fans can expect new challenges in season five. Instead of merely addressing the humorous tribulations of farm life, the new episodes will delve into more serious topics, reflecting a major health scare that has led Clarkson to reconsider his frenetic pace. Alongside this backdrop, viewers can anticipate the added chaos of new "Easy Care" sheep arriving, alongside the bureaucratic challenges posed by recent UK government policies. Plus, gadgets like robot tractors will make their debut, adding a technological twist to his rural adventures. The five-part series will kick off with the first four episodes on June 3, with the latter installments scheduled for release on June 10 and June 17. For Clarkson fans, this season promises the usual mix of farce and sincerity, reflecting both the rewards and the realities of farming life.
